Presa de Vinçà
Presa de Vinçà is a dam in Rodès, Arrondissement of Prades, Occitanie. Presa de Vinçà is situated nearby to the church Église Saint-Pierre de Belloch, as well as near the archaeological site Dolmen de la Guardiola.Photo: Robert66, Public domain.

Saint-Félix de Ropidera Church
Church
Photo: Mairierodes, Public domain.
The Saint-Félix de Ropidera Church is a ruined, fortified Romanesque church located in the deserted medieval village of Ropidera, in the commune of Rodès, in the French department of Pyrénées-Orientales. Saint-Félix de Ropidera Church is situated 1 km north of Presa de Vinçà.
